Job description
We require for our client an Infrastructure Engineer specialising in Automation and Virtualisation.

A high profile role ensuring the integrity and security of the ICT Operations within this government agency.

You must have the ability to obtain Baseline Security Clearance.
The successful candidate will be joining the team that is responsible for the management of all data centers, virtualization, automation, storage, backup and restore capability. They also cover after hours on-call support for our infrastructure.

Our client is looking for an Infrastructure engineer who specialises in Automation and Storage.

Duties:
Managing and improving Aria Automation, NSX-T and VMware vSphere environment and server infrastructure
Accountable for developing monitoring systems such as Aria Operations
Producing design documents, build documents, operations documents
Mentoring junior team members.

Skills:
Experience in Aria Automation 8.x , Aria Orchestrator, VMware NSX-T, VMware vSphere, Aria Operations, Site Recovery Manager
Scripting and coding experience in PowerShell • PowerCLI • YAML • JavaScript
Produce design, build and operations documents for processes and procedures.
